## Configuration

The ChipGate reader daemon for the Varnmouth Marathon reads settings from `/etc/chipgate/reader.env`. Set `READER_MAT_ID` to the mat's position code (e.g. `FINISH-02`) and `UPLINK_HOST` to the timing server used by Stridewell Systems. Poll interval defaults to 50ms; don't lower it on battery mats. All vars are plain key=value, no quoting. The uplink also requires an auth token, set on the next line of the env file.

env line for kahof-yahag: RELAY_SECRET5=224bf

## Vendor Note: Taxlattice Rate-Lookup Cache

Our checkout service caches tax rates from the Taxlattice vendor feed for six hours. Before each release, confirm the cache warmer completed against the latest feed snapshot; stale rates have previously caused reconciliation discrepancies in the Veldmark region. The vendor publishes rate changes on Tuesdays, so avoid Tuesday-morning cutovers. For feed outages or contract questions, contact our Taxlattice account liaison at the address below.

escalation mailbox, hadug-bajog: sormir@norvalabs.internal

# Batching layer for the Wrengate GraphQL schema.
# Fixes the N+1 pattern plugin resolvers kept triggering: child
# field loads are now coalesced per tick into a single backend
# fetch. Plugin authors: do not call the store directly from
# resolvers; use the provided loader or batching breaks for
# everyone. Batch windows and size caps below are load-tested;
# override at your own risk. Current values are as follows.

tuning constants:
QUOTAS = {
    "quenael": 10,
    "oliwyn": 1,
}

Handover: Garage occupancy feed (Stallbrook Parking)

For the incoming owner and the security reviewer: the occupancy feed aggregates sensor counts from the Stallbrook garages and publishes deltas every thirty seconds. Sensor payloads are signed at the edge and verified before ingestion; anything failing verification is quarantined, not dropped, so the queue can grow during sensor firmware rollouts. Rate limits on the public read endpoint are enforced at the gateway. The production settings in effect today are these.

settings of yaguf-fajof:
[druvan]
host = druvan.plorvatech.example
user = druvan_svc
database = druvan_prod